Transaction ec8d73d85b6a080d124e48f01ec13db636be7949a1c8b4085f866023cee90211
1 Input
1 Output
-
ec8d73d85b6a080d124e48f01ec13db636be7949a1c8b4085f866023cee90211:0
- value
- 101643
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2fa488ee14b91d9c5f787fe94339b95c76e3ad8
- address
- bc1qctay3rhpfwgan30hsllfgvumjhrkuwkctvkl7q